The art club had an election to select a president. 9 out of the 12 members of the art club voted in the election. What percentage of the members voted?

Answer: There is 75% of the members voted.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we have given that

Number of members of the art club = 12

Number of members who voted in the elections = 9

We need to find the percentage of the members voted.

So, percentage would be

[tex]}{\dfrac{\text{Number of people voted}}{\text{total number of people}}\\\\=\dfrac{9}{12}\times 100\\\\=\dfrac{900}{12}\\\\=75\%[/tex]

Hence, there is 75% of the members voted.
